More about the book
Focusing on inclusive education, this insightful book provides teachers with practical strategies to enhance their teaching practices in primary schools. It emphasizes the importance of creating an inclusive environment that benefits all students, including those with diverse learning needs. With thought-provoking ideas and approaches, it serves as a valuable resource for educators aiming to foster a supportive and effective learning atmosphere.
